An excellent opportunity has arisen for a Patient Coordinator to join our friendly team.
Our client manufactures specialist medical food and equipment for internally (through tubes) fed patients, to improve patient quality of life and meet their nutritional needs.
Hospital2Home’s (H2H) role is to support the patients feeding once they have left the hospital and returned home.H2H work closely with our dedicated nursing service who oversee the clinical aspects of patient feeding. The H2H customer service coordinator plays an integral front line role and is committed to delivering the highest levels of service to patients.
This role is for someone who enjoys working as part of a friendly team and wants to make a difference to people’s lives. The team works in an open plan office within a modern building. You will also undergo our training program overseen by our team trainer.
